Smart Room Divider Ideas with IKEA IVAR – Real Showroom Photos

Dividing a room doesn't always require walls or expensive built-ins. With a little creativity, IKEA's IVAR shelving system can do the job just as well – and look great while doing it. This timeless pine series is one of IKEA's most versatile, and when used in wider formats, it becomes a stylish and functional room divider for open spaces, bedrooms, or studio apartments.

Why IVAR Works as a Room Divider
Unlike fixed walls or bulky partitions, IVAR offers flexibility. You can keep the structure open and airy or close it off with cabinet doors, pegboards, or boxes. The wooden shelves provide natural warmth and a Scandinavian feel that blends well with most interiors. Plus, the modular system lets you adjust shelves, add elements, or combine with other units to suit your needs.

Is IVAR Stable Enough?
Yes, IVAR is surprisingly sturdy when assembled correctly. The vertical side posts are made of solid pine, and metal cross-braces add stability. If you're placing IVAR freestanding in the middle of a room, it's smart to fix the back with extra diagonal supports and keep heavier items toward the bottom. For extra safety in homes with kids or pets, consider anchoring one side to a wall or floor with discreet brackets.

Different Ways to Use IVAR as a Divider
Here are some examples and ideas:
-
Open shelving divider: Stack books, baskets, and plants while keeping visibility across the room.
-
Wine rack & cabinet combo: Combine open shelves with wine storage and closed base units for a kitchen or dining area divider.
-
Children's zone: Create a play space with shelves on one side and a craft station on the other. Add SKÅDIS pegboards for extra function.
-
Under-stair solutions: Use IVAR to zone awkward spaces or low ceilings without blocking light.
-
Studio zoning: Separate your bed from the living space with a wide IVAR structure, combining storage and privacy.

Choosing the Right IVAR Width for Dividers
When using IVAR as a room divider, go for the wider shelf units. The 50 cm wide version creates a more stable and impactful structure compared to the narrow 30 cm option. It also makes the divider feel more substantial and functional as part of your space.

Styling Tips
Keep IVAR looking clean and modern by:
-
Leaving the pine natural or applying a transparent matte lacquer
-
Painting the frame in a soft tone like sage green, white, or charcoal
-
Using rattan doors or fabric panels for semi-transparency
-
Adding decorative storage boxes or LED lighting to elevate the look
